Swansea City 'considering move for Martin Skrtel'

Swansea City are reportedly considering a move for former Liverpool centre-back Martin Skrtel, who currently plays for Turkish side Fenerbahce.

Swansea City are reportedly considering a summer move for former Liverpool defender Martin Skrtel.

Skrtel ended an eight-year stay at Anfield when he joined Fenerbahce last summer, but he has now been linked with a return to the Premier League after just a season away.

The 32-year-old is contracted to the Turkish outfit until 2019, but Fotomac claims that he could be sold in order to ease Fenerbahce's financial worries.

Swansea reportedly want to use the money generated from the sale of Bafetimbi Gomis to fund their move for the Slovakian centre-back.

Skrtel made 47 appearances across all competitions for Fenerbahce last season but is thought to be open to the idea of leaving the club this summer.
